Analyzing satellite images in Google Earth Engine with BigQuery SQL

Google Earth Engine (GEE) is a groundbreaking product that has been available for research and government use for more than a decade. Google Cloud recently launched GEE to General Availability for commercial use. This blog post describes a method to utilize GEE from within BigQuery’s SQL allowing SQL speakers to get access to and value from the vast troves of data available within Earth Engine.

How to simplify and fast-track your data warehouse migrations using BigQuery Migration Service

Migrating data to the cloud can be a daunting task. Especially moving data from warehouses and legacy environments requires a systematic approach. These migrations usually need manual effort and can be error-prone. They are complex and involve several steps such as planning, system setup, query translation, schema analysis, data movement, validation, and performance optimization.

Scaling Kafka Brokers in Cloudera Data Hub

This blog post will provide guidance to administrators currently using or interested in using Kafka nodes to maintain cluster changes as they scale up or down to balance performance and cloud costs in production deployments. Kafka brokers contained within host groups enable the administrators to more easily add and remove nodes. This creates flexibility to handle real-time data feed volumes as they fluctuate.
